#b7e294 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b7e294 is composed of 71.8% red, 88.6%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19% cyan, 0% magenta, 34.5%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 93.1 degrees, a saturation of 57.4% and a lightness of 73.3%. #b7e294 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6fc529.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

Shades and Tints of #b7e294
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#f5fbf1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b7e294
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bbbdb9 is the less saturated color, while #b4fc7a is the most saturated one.
